Output ef9ca8243b5b2864359454f2be8cc7d620610c18a3591bd26f9b29f487d5f7bc:4

value
784528865
script pubkey
OP_0 OP_PUSHBYTES_20 5fdc24253027c68c20acc9b0a6c6ede7066a107c
address
tb1qtlwzgffsylrgcg9vexc2d3hduurx5yrut2ny26
transaction
ef9ca8243b5b2864359454f2be8cc7d620610c18a3591bd26f9b29f487d5f7bc
confirmations
131807
spent
true